Quote:
Originally Posted by Blake745 View Post
It was and I looked over fuses one second time and found a blown fuse

Glad it works now.

So, what camera are you guys using, I’m looking on amazon and I’m not sure which is a good and reliable buy.

Also, I’ve noticed when I place the car in reverse back up camera screen comes on and audio stops, Bluetooth music etc. It is kinda annoying, any way to stop that?
Do you mean a reverse camera? Yes mine is in place of one of the rear license plate lights, BUT I do not recommend this fitting, it's not central and the hole is off-square. I'd go for one that is a license plate surround, where it is centralised.

As for it cutting the volume, no sorry I'm not currently aware of a way around that. Saying that I'd rather have the sound go and concentrate on reversing and hearing the sensor sounds properly.

Quote:
Originally Posted by LordLolzeye View Post
Is android 9 update out for the first generation screens? DavesZed
The official answer to that is NO.
Apparently this company designed the e89 unit to run on Android 8.1 even though Android 9 was already out, and to cap it off they didn't write in an upgradable ability!! So our units cannot have Android 9, unless we want to buy a new mainboard, and then have Android 9, 6 core processor and 4GB RAM and that's about $150.
Now to be fair, having Android 9 wouldn't make a lot of difference to how you'd use it. The 6 core processor and 4GB RAM would but then you wouldn't have that anyway. I've just changed my phone from one with A 8.1 to A9 and I can't really tell the difference for day-to-day usage .
There is an update to the new ID7 UI along with a few other tweeks but it doesn't make it run any better. I've had the earlier version of this update and I'm still trying to see if anything has actually improved apart from visually and so far no it hasn't (in fact it's caused me a lot of trouble getting it working again after installing the update, hence why I pulled my link to it) They are, allegedly, updating the update so hopefully a clean working "out of the box" update will be available shortly.
Honestly though I don't really like the ID7 UI, the integration into this environment seems rushed and clunky and ill thought out. One improvement though is that if you have added any extra music apps (Carplay, Spotify etc) then the process to get the steering wheel buttons working is a lot quicker now.
